[Résolu] Problème de restriction d'affichage des blocs en fonction des nodes

Information importante

En raison d'un grand nombre d'inscriptions de spammers sur notre site, polluant sans relache notre forum, nous suspendons la création de compte via le formulaire de "sign up".

Il est néanmoins toujours possible de devenir adhérent•e en faisant la demande sur cette page, rubrique "Inscription" : https://www.drupal.fr/contact


De plus, le forum est désormais "interdit en écriture". Il n'est plus autorisé d'y écrire un sujet/billet/commentaire.

Pour contacter la communauté, merci de rejoindre le slack "drupalfrance".

Si vous voulez contacter le bureau de l'association, utilisez le formulaire disponible ici, ou envoyez-nous un DM sur twitter.

Bonjour,

Je suis nouveau sous Drupal, et ayant crée un site de test en local, je m'amuse à expérimenter tout ce qui me passe sous la main.

Cependant j'ai un bug assez important qui se passe.. Ou c'est moi qui utilise mal ma chose.

J'explique : Dans la gestion de la structure, lorsque je vais dans la gestion des blocs et j'essaie de restreindre l'affichage de certains blocs en listant des URL dans le cadre prévu à cet effet, et j'enregistre ces modifications. En allant voir sur les pages, les modifications ne sont pas ce qu'elles devraient être.
Donc quand je coche 'Toutes les pages sauf celles listées ' toutes les pages affichent le bloc :O
et quand je coche 'Seulement les pages listées ' aucune page du site n'affiche le bloc..

J'ai essayé les URL sous la forme modifiée par autopath, et sous la forme de node/xx..

Ma question, est-ce normal ou un bug de Drupal? Et comment résoudre mon problème?

Merci d'avance,

Azerla

PS : Je suis sous Drupal 7.12

Version de Drupal : 

"Donc quand je coche ‘Toutes les pages sauf celles listées ’ toutes les pages affichent le bloc"
-> c'est ok
"et quand je coche ‘Seulement les pages listées ’ aucune page du site n’affiche le bloc"
->dis comme cela, c'est ok aussi! Il faut que tu signales dans le cadre juste en-dessous, la node (ou les nodes) sur laquelle tu souhaites voir apparaître le bloc en question.
Enregistrer le bloc. Ensuite, si tu tapes l'url de cette node dans ton navigateur, tu constateras la présence du bloc.

Bon amusement

Ben justement, c'est pour tout les URLs et pas seulement ceux listés... Et ça c'est un problème.. Non?

Donc seulement afficher sur les URLs listés : aucun URL même ceux listés n'affichent le bloc,
Afficher sur toutes les pages sauf celles listées, toutes affichent même celles listées..

J'ai toujours pas trouvé de réponse, bien que j'ai essayé sur d'autre serveurs locaux et en ligne.. Et j'ai toujours le même problème.. Tu as bien drupal 7.12?

Sinon help à tous ceux qui pourraient aider !! ^^"

Par exemple je veux afficher un bloc uniquement sur la page où sommes nous, je coche, afficher uniquement sur les pages listées et je mets dans la liste en dessous :

http://localhost/mon_dossier/?q=fr/content/o-sommes-nous

et quand j'ai essayé avec l'URL par node :

http://localhost/mon_dossier/?q=fr/node/14

Est-ce correct? normalement oui.. j'ai déjà configuré des choses comme ça (page d'accueil etc)

Pour ceux qui rencontreront le même problème, il ne faut absolument pas tout mettre!

Il faut soit mettre : node/XX (attention pas de / avant le node)
soit si vous faites des alias d'URL: nom_de_la_page

Merci bien et bonne soirée ;)